How To Fix CNV_MBT_DEL_620002 - For &1 tables deletion parameters are collected and saved.


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: CNV_MBT_DEL_620 - Messages for generic deletion programs (selection, run, ...)

  • Message number: 002

  • Message text: For &1 tables deletion parameters are collected and saved.
